Located in the Alta Vista neighborhood of midtown San Antonio, Outlaw Kitchens is a small, neighborhood eatery and market offering both takeaway and dining in.

The menu consists of Chef Paul Sartory's nightly suppers plus a vegetarian or vegan option. A typical night at Outlaw Kitchens might include an appetizer of RISOTTO with fresh gulf shrimp and snow peas and an entree of GRILLED HANGER STEAK with FRENCH FRIED ONIONS. His vegetarian dishes are standouts as well with handmade pasta, curries and braises as his mainstays. i.e. GNOCCHI PIEMONTAISE with roasted butternut squash, cremini mushrooms, sautéed spinach and shaved parmesan.

In addition to the nightly menu the “OK” market offers a line of handmade, frozen dinners and unique wares ranging from locally crafted pottery to Paul’s homemade marmalades.
Chef Paul Sartory and his wife Peggy Howe are transplants from Upstate New York where Paul was a Senior Chef Instructor at the Culinary Institute of America in Hyde Park.
While working for the CIA, Paul developed the concept of Outlaw Kitchens. His idea was simple. He would offer one dinner nightly at a price that his friends and neighbors could afford on a regular basis. With fresh, seasonal ingredients in mind and a wife who is skilled in historical renovations they succeeded in turning an 80 year old limestone bungalow located on a quarter acre of land into their home, garden and restaurant. Six years in the making, they believe they got it right and hope that you do too!

Chef Paul Sartory...
Chef Paul Sartory began his cooking career after graduating from the Culinary Institute of America in Hyde Park, NY at the age of 20.
As a young man Paul studied with Alain Ducasse in Monte Carlo and ran the American Bounty Restaurant at the CIA New York campus.
He spent the following 3 decades opening high profile restaurants around the U.S. and teaching for the CIA in Hyde Park, Napa and San Antonio.
Paul has had the honor of representing the United States at the Bocuse D' Or. Founded by the late, great, iconic chef, Paul Bocuse, the Bocuse D’ Or is considered to be the most prestigious cooking competition in the world.
Other highlights of his career include opening the CIA's Wine Spectator Restaurant in Napa Valley and running the kitchens of America's top two country clubs, The Cherokee Town and Country Club of Atlanta and The Belle Meade of Nashville.
